The Asian Development Bank (ADB) has approved a $42 million loan for coastal protection and disaster resilience in Maharashtra.
The key components include the construction and rehabilitation of coastal defenses, enhancement of early warning systems, community engagement and capacity building, and sustainable coastal management.
The project will improve safety by reducing the risk of loss of life and property, support economic growth, and promote environmental sustainability in coastal areas.
The ADB is a multilateral development finance institution that works to reduce poverty in Asia and the Pacific through loans, grants, and technical assistance.
This project is crucial for Maharashtra as it aims to protect the long coastline from the impacts of climate change and natural disasters, ensuring the safety and economic well-being of coastal communities.
NAREDCO Maharashtra president Prashant Sharma welcomes the initiative, stating it will benefit the real estate sector, particularly in affordable housing.
